文章编号:74 /
分类:
互联网资讯 /
更新时间:2024-04-25 06:03:18 / 浏览:
次
嵌入式软件是嵌入在硬件中的操作系统和开发工具软件。嵌入式软件是根据应用需求定向开发,因此每种嵌入式软件都有自己独特的应用性和实用价值。
嵌入式计算机系统
嵌入式计算机系统是隐藏在一些更大的系统中,管理控制这些系统,并带有微
处理器的专用软硬件系统。通常称为嵌入式系统。嵌入式系统是运行在嵌入式
芯片中的,
学习嵌入式软件通常从51单片机开始,流水灯基本是每一个嵌入式软件工程师的第一堂必修课。
嵌入式软件开发
嵌入式软件开发是指在嵌入式操作系统下进行应用软件开发的技术人员,包含在系统化设计方案具体指导下的硬件和软件及其综合性产品研发。偏重于在一定硬件标准下的系统化设计方案和软件产品研发。
嵌入式软件开发主要使用的语言是C/C++、Ada。
嵌入式软件开发要学什么
1. C语言编程
C语言是嵌入式领域最重要也是最主要的编程语言,通过大量编程实例重点理解C语言的基础编程以及高级编程知识。
2. 操作系统:LINUX,WINCE等
现在主流的是LINUX,建议学习LINUX,并且还需要充分了解这些基础知识。
3. 硬件知识:ARM,FPGA,DSP等
要有一定的了解。
4. 实践能力
要具备较强的实践能力。
5. 数据结构及算法
在嵌入式底层驱动、通信协议、及各种引擎开发中会得到大量应用,对其掌握的好坏直接影响程序的效率、简洁及健壮性。
6. 交叉编译、makefile、shell脚本等
在实际的开发中还会涉及很多东西。
嵌入式软件开发就业前景
学习嵌入式就业前景广泛,你可以做
手机、PDA、MP3、MP4、遥控玩具、
PSP、
相机、家电控制(洗衣机、电饭煲等)、汽车导航仪,只要是跟电子控制相关的行业。
根据权威部门统计,我国嵌入式人才缺口每年50万人左右。
嵌入式软件开发是未来几年最热门和最受欢迎的职业之一,具有10年工作经验的高级嵌入式工程师年薪在30万元左右。即使是初级的嵌入式软件开发人员,平均月薪也达到了5—8K,中高级的嵌入式工程师月薪10-30K。随着
5G时代的到来,嵌入式开发人才的薪水还会进一步水涨船高!
什么样的人适合学习嵌入式
一类是学电子工程、通信工程等偏硬件专业出身的人。
另一类是学软件、参加嵌入式培训以及计算机专业出身的人。
相关标签:
嵌入式软件开发、
本文地址:https://www.zdmsl.com/demo/001/article/74.html
上一篇:稳定币深入了解稳定币的定义和用途...
下一篇:PPC付费广告指南了解PPC和CPC之间的关键差...